PR and Publicity
Demystified

Most of the top hundred law firms and barristers' chambers retain PR and Publicity agencies and have a dedicated PR and communications employee within their marketing departments.

The average cost of retaining an external agency is £50,000 per annum and the average cost of hiring an employee experienced in Media Relations is £35,000 plus any expenses incurred in using outside agencies.

On the whole, external agencies are more successful at securing the required publicity, although our discussions with the journalists have revealed that they would like to be able to talk to qualified lawyers, as it makes their job easier.
